The Metropolitan Orchestras (TMO) concert on February 20 will be the first in a uniquely designed 2021 concert season which will see all of TMO’s mainstage Met concerts presented from charming and intimate local venues. Led by Chief Conductor Sarah-Grace Williams with TMO’s dynamic string section, the String Fantasy performance includes works from two well-known Australian composers along with two fabulous pieces from international composers. The evening commences with a premiere from acclaimed Australian composer Elena Kats-Chernin who has created a new orchestration of Fast Blue Village specifically for this ensemble. Following is the Carmen Fantasy for Flute and Strings by Bizet which has been arranged by Brett Thompson and features TMO Principal Flute, Svetlana Yaroslavskaya. Paul Stanhope’s Morning Star and Asger Hamerik’s Symphony Number 6 will complete this showcase evening to kick off TMO’s exciting and distinctive 2021 season.
